Can Dark Chocolate Be Eaten on a Sugar-Free Diet?

Yes, dark chocolate can be eaten on a sugar-free diet if you choose options labeled as sugar-free or low-sugar. Brands like Lily’s and ChocZero offer sugar-free varieties with high cocoa content, perfect for those avoiding sugar.
